Moth Of The Week
Moth of the Week
Drinker
Euthrix potatoria

The drinker moth is of the family Lasiocampidae. It was described and named in 1758 by Carl Linneaus. Linneaus chose the species name potatoria as it means ‘drinker-like.’ Dutch entomologist Johannes Goedaert had previously called the moth dronckaerdt, meaning ‘drunkard,’ “because it is very much inclined to drinking” or because this moth repeatedly puts its head into water. The common name ‘drinker’ comes from the same reason.
Description This moth is distinguishable from other eggar moths by a diagonal line crossing the forewing and two white spots also on the forewing. Males are usually reddish or orangish-brown with yellow patches. Males in East Anglia are often yellowish. Females can be yellow, a pale buff, whitish, or a darker reddish-brown than the males. Male and females also differ in size and antennae shape: females are slight larger than males, and males have fluffier antennae.
Wingspan Range of Fully Grown Drinker: 45–65 mm (≈1.77 - 2.56 in)
Diet and Habitat The caterpillars of this species feed on grasses and reeds in genuses such as Alopecurus, Deschampsia, Dactylis, Elytrigia, Carex, Luzula, and other Gramineae. A few examples are Cat grass (Dactylis glomeratus), Common Reed (Phragmites australis), Reed Canary-grass (Phalaris arundinacea), and Wood Small-reed (Calamagrostis epigejos).
In the spring, they feed mainly at night and can be found resting on low vegetation during the day. The larva also supposedly drink morning dew because it had been observed to repeatedly put its head in water.
This moth can be found in Europe. It is common throughout England and Ireland but tends to favor western Scotland over eastern Scotland. It prefers habitats of marshy places such as fens, riversides, tall and damp grassland, marshes, damp open woodland, scrub, and ditches. However this species does sometimes live in drier habitats such as grassy terrain and urban gardens.
Mating Adults can been seen between July and August and presumably mate during this time. There is only one generation per year. Eggs are laid mainly on the stems of grasses or reeds in small clusters.
Predators Adult moths fly at night and are presumably preyed on by nocturnal predators such as bats.
Fun Fact Both sexes of the drinker moth are attracted to light, but males are especially susceptible.

Moth of the Week
Antler Moth
Cerapteryx graminis

The antler moth is a part of the family Noctuidae. It was first described in 1758 by Carl Linnaeus. This moth gets its name from the antler shaped mark in its forewings.
Description This moth species has brown forewings, with a “basal streak” of white that branches out. This mark may vary in size per moth. The forewings show a mirrored pattern of the base brown broken up by the branches and a few spots and lines of lighter brown. The forewing also may or may not have black streaks. The hindwing is dark brown with a white fringe.
Males are smaller than females with fluffier antennae.
Male Wingspan: 27 - 32mm (≈1.06 - 1.26in)
Female Wingspan: 35 - 39mm (≈1.38 - 1.53in)
Diet and Habitat The larva of this species feeds on grasses such as Deschampsia, Sheep’s-fescue (Festuca ovina), Mat-grass (Nardus stricta) and Purple Moor-grass (Molinia caerulea). It has also been found on sedges and rushes. When the larva population is concentrated enough, they can damage pastures. Adults feed on flowers such as thistles and ragworts.
This species is common through most of Europe. It’s northernmost reach is Iceland and above the Arctic Circle. It’s easternmost reach is Siberia and North Mongolia. This moth does not occur in the dry southern regions of Europe. It has been introduced to North America. Additionally, this species inhabits the Alps. They prefer habitats of grassland, favouring acid upland pasture, moorland and downland.
Mating Adult moths are seen flying from July to September. They presumably mate in this time frame.
Predators This moth flies during the day, especially in the north, warm weather, and early mornings, and at night. They are presumably preyed on by both daytime and night time predators like birds and bats. They are attracted to light. To protect themselves during the day, this moth hides in the grass.
Fun Fact The antler moth rises to an altitude of 2100 meters in the Alps.

Moth of the Week
Latticed Heath
Chiasmia clathrata

The lattice heath is a part of the family Geometridae, first described in 1758 by Carl Linnaeus. Linnaeus however described this moth under the name Phalaena clathrata. This was later changed by Eugen Wehril in 1949 to Semiothisa clathrata tschangkuensis. Then, Malcolm J. Scoble proved it was not in the genus Semiothisa as the Semiothisa species are found only in the Americas. Molecular work has confirmed the this species within the Chiasmia genus.
Description Both the forewings and hindwings are the same color, which can vary from yellow to white depending on the moth. The veins of the wings are traced out in brown and criss crossed by several larger uneven brown lines. This is where the species got its common name “latticed.” The lines vary in thickness to the point some moths’ wings a more almost entirely brown. Close to the edges of the wings are several small brown spots and a brown and white edge on what is called the “outer margin.”
The body and antennae are mottled to match the wings.
Wingspan Range: 20 - 25 mm (≈0.79 - 0.98 in)
Diet and Habitat The larvea of this moth eat hedge bedstraw, yellow bedstraw, clovers, trefoils, lucerne, meadow vetchling, and other legumes. Adult moths do not feed.
This moth is found through Europe and ranges south to the Near East and North Africa and east through Russia, Siberia, northern Iran, Kazakhstan, China, and Korea to Japan. It is very common in the British Isles. It prefers open area habitats such as grassland, moorland, and waste ground.
Mating This species has one to two generations per year in the British Isles. The pupa overwinter and Amadults emerge in May to September.
Predators This moth species is binaural, meaning they fly during the day. However, they are attached to artificial light and can be seen flying at night for these lights. Because of this it is presumable that they are preyed on by birds and bats, two common predators of moths.
Fun Fact This moth has 4 subspecies: Chiasmia clathrata clathrata (Linné), Chiasmia clathrata centralasiae (Krulikowski, 1911), Chiasmia clathrata djakonovi (Kardakoff, 1928), Chiasmia clathrata kurilata (Bryk, 1942).

Moth of the Week
Salt Marsh Moth
Estigmene acrea

The salt marsh moth is a part of the family Erebidae. This species was first described in 1773 by Dru Drury. It is also known as the acrea moth.
Description Both male and female moths have white heads, thoraxes, and forewings with a varying pattern of black spots on the forewings, with some moths having no pattern at all. They also share an orange-yellow abdomen with a vertical line of back dots. On the male, the hindwings are the same organge yellow while on females the hindwings are white. Both males and females have three or four black dots on each hindwing.
Wingspan Range: 4.5 - 6.8 cm (≈1.77 - 2.68 in)
Diet and Habitat The caterpillar was first thought to be a pest to salt-grass, but in fact it prefers weeds, vegetables, and field crops such as dandelions, cabbage, cotton, walnuts, apple, tobacco, pea, potato, clovers, and maize. Adults do not feed.
This moth is found in North America, the Democratic Republic of the Congo, Kenya, Colombia, and Mexico. It prefers open habitats such as openings in woods, thickets, farm fields, grasslands, and marshes. It is called the “salt marsh moth” because it is common in coastal salt marshes (tidal marshes) along Pacific, Atlantic, and Gulf coasts.
Mating This species of moth does not emit pheromones from the tip of its abdomen but instead from its throat or the to of its abdomen. These moths are seen from May to August but can be seen all year in southern Florida and Texas. It is presumably during May and August they mate in most parts of their range while they mate all year round in Florida and Texas.
Yellowish eggs are laid in clusters on the host plant leaves. Females usually produce 400 to 1000 eggs in one or more clusters. It is possible to find a single egg cluster containing 1200 eggs. Eggs hatch in four to five days.
Predators This species is frequently parasitized as larvae, usually by flies in the Tachinidae family. In Arizona, the most common parasites were Exorista mellea and Leschenaultia adusta while two other parasitic flies were also seen: Gymnocarcelia ricinorum and Lespesia archippivora.
Both the larval and egg stages are oararzitized by Hymenopteran parasitoids such as Apanteles diacrisiae; Therion fuscipenne, T. morio, Casinaria genuina, Hyposoter rivalis; Psychophagus omnivorus, Tritneptis hemerocampae Vierick; Anastatus reduvii; and Trichogramma semifumatum.
A cytoplasmic polyhedrosis virus is known to harm this species but there are little data on its importance and effect.
General predators such as lady beetles, softwinged flower beetles, and assassin bugs prey on these caterpillars, but are not thought to have a large impact on population.
Fun Fact This species has 4 subspecies: Estigmene acrea acrea, Estigmene acrea arizonensis (Rothschild, (1910)) (Arizona), Estigmene acrea mexicana (Walker, (1865)) (Mexico), Estigmene acrea columbiana (Rothschild, (1910)) (Colombia).

Moth of the Week
Kentish Glory
Endromis versicolora

The Kentish glory was first described in 1758 by Carl Linnaeus. It is a part of the family Endromidae which was created in 1810 by Ferdinand Ochsenheimer. This is a monotypic genus, meaning there is only one species in it being the Kentish glory.
Description The male and female of this species are clearly told apart by their colors and size.
Males are darker and more orange than females with feathery antennae
Males hindwings are orange
Females are paler/more washed out in color and larger to carry eggs
The forewings of this moth are a marbled black, orange, and white. The outer edge of the wing called the outer margin is brown with white stripes along the veins. The females hindwings are the same marbled black, brown, and white with a brown edge. The males hindwings are orange with brown markings.
The legs and antennae are black while the thorax is brown and white. The females abdomen is black while the males abdomen is a similar orange to the hindwing.
Sources differ on wingspan range.
Wikipedia: 50 - 70 mm (≈1.97 - 2.76 in)
Butterfly Conservation: Male 27 - 30 mm (≈1.06 - 1.18 in), Female 34 - 39 mm (≈1.34 - 1.54 in)
Diet and Habitat The larvae of this species eats mainly birch (Betula species) but will eat other trees and shrubs such as Alnus, Corylus, Tilia and Carpinus species. Adults do not feed.
This moth’s range used to be much larger, such as living in the southern and western English counties of Kent, Sussex, Berkshire, East Anglia, Herefordshire, and Worcestershire and the southeastern Welsh county of Monmouthsire.
Now this moth is restricted to living in the central and eastern Highlands of Scotland. It is seen in the Scottish counties of Perthshire, Inverness-shire, Morayshire, Aberdeenshire and Kincardineshire.
They prefer to inhabit open birch woodland and lightly wooded moorland.
Mating Females use pheromones to attract males, who can detect them from 1-2 km (≈0.62 - 1.24 mi) away.
This species has one single generation per year. The females lay their eggs, which are yellow at first then purplish-brown, in batches of 10-20 eggs on low birch scrub at an average height of 1.2m (≈1.31 yd). They prefer to let them on sheltered, unshaded saplings, usually the first few batches are near where the females emerged. The eggs hatch after 10 to 14 days.
Predators Males usually fly during the day from mid morning to early afternoon while females fly at dusk. Because of this males are presumably preyed on by daytime birds while females are preyed on by bats.
Fun Fact The females do not fly as strong as males due to the eggs they carry as it weighs them down. Females tend to lay their first few batches of eggs close to where they emerged due to this fact.
